I noticed your tag says " Falken Wildpeak A/T3W LT295/70R18 on Method MR305 NV 18x9, +18 wheels " Do you have any updated pictures with that size of tire/rim? Everywhere I've seen with a 2" level there is no rubbing. I hope this is the case because I've ordered it all.. xD. Can you confirm? :D
I do not rub on the crash bars or any suspension components themselves. I do rub on the left side air deflector, the hard plastic piece that’s there for wind deflection. For that reason I have played with the idea of getting the tremor front slide plate because I’m hopeful/pretty sure it would eliminate that rubbing (plus it allows more approach angle clearance: a better function duh 😅) every kit is difference in terms of handling and actual ride height but I will provide some pictures here shortly. I’m currently at 12k miles now for reference

I do remember now that they do rub against the mud flaps! I took them off because of that reason, but so many more rocks were spitting up so I put them back on. The 10k miles on the tread life probably helped a little? But when I reverse turning right, they do hit. I don’t care at this point 🤷🏻‍♂️ comes with the territory and it’s only at a certain angle. I wish the flexible mudflaps existed as an OEM option because I would get those instead.
